Hoffman has expanded its thermal management product offering with Type 4 indoor/outdoor T4 airconditioners designed to provide high-efficiency positive cooling for wall-mount and free-standing enclosures.
This new line offers a wider range of protective capabilities and more BTUs of cooling to protect electronic controls and equipment from potential failure caused by excessive heat inside a sealed enclosure.
"System failure due to inadequate thermal management can have a significant impact on the bottom line, costing the company not only replacement of the controls, but loss of production as well," explained Greg Quick, Hoffman product manager. "Airconditioners and other thermal management solutions are typically less expensive than the components and controls they protect. By proactively addressing thermal needs, companies can significantly minimise potential problems."
T4 airconditioners are available in six models with varying footprints and capacities - from the small 40 x 19 x 16 cm, 800 BTU unit for wall-mount enclosures or enclosures with narrow side walls, to the large 134 x 53 x 33 cm, 20 000 BTU model. Each airconditioner maintains a UL/cUL Type 4 rating.
"Hoffman now provides even more cooling solutions for a broader variety of industry applications and needs," adds Quick. "T4 airconditioners support the entire range of applications from small densely-populated enclosures, to large enclosures housing drives and motors with greater heat dissipation needs."
These closed loop airconditioner cooling solutions are designed and tested to maintain a UL50-rated separation of the external ambient airflow from the sealed cabinet interior. Airconditioners lower the internal enclosure temperature below the ambient temperature, and remove harmful and unwanted humidity from enclosure or cabinet interiors.
All models are equipped with head pressure control for low ambient operation, a compressor heater, coated condenser coil, and thermostat.
